Definitions:

Neuroticism

A personality trait characterized by anxiety, fear, moodiness, worry, envy, frustration, jealousy, and loneliness.

False Assurance

Giving someone confidence or hope based on promises or assurances that are not guaranteed or may not be true.

Reassuring

Providing comfort or support to someone, often to alleviate doubts or fears.

Parroting

The act of mindlessly repeating what someone else has said without understanding or thought.
